xtus:Most European countries do not recognise Nigeria as an English speaking country due to our multi lingual ( different cultural Language) system. That is why we are always requested to present an English Test result. Although some school will accept letter of exemption if you have one from school or from Ministry of Education Abuja. The stress is much for the exemption. Contact the school and inform them that you have done your bachelors in English and provide proof. You might be exempted from the English language requirement, if not, I will implore you to write the exam as it will be valuable in other things .. the result or certificate last for 2 years. |

Dear All, For those who have gotten admission Congratulations and those who hasn’t, don’t feel bad it’s a process it will come in time.. but always try to contact the school, call them or mail them. But they prefer call, because they will give answers to your questions immediately. Mails take time. For those applying for visa... Visa application isn’t so hard.. the right document Certainly results in visa... just be consistent in your response... if you have given A answers before maintain that A as answers all through the processing because two different answers shows inconsistencies and gives doubt on your purpose of travel... For sponsorship... Always check the latest requirements before you submission for Visa.. Sometimes they change the requirements during current academic year and it affects students because they only considered requirements for previous year.. I was in that shoe n I was refused.. when you want to submit for visa check again the requirements for sponsorship (latest) (2020/2021). If it’s not there... Please wait for it. For those who will go for interview... Give same answers to questions...they have almost same questions but different ways of asking them, so understand the question n give same answer just as the one you gave to previously. N:B Don’t promise heaven before coming to Belgium.. things might go differently ... if you have loaned money for all processing, give a year or two pay back plan. Don’t expect immediate earnings.. no be beans... When you are certain of your arrival.. please start contacting your friends or family in the city where you will school n ask help for accommodation... it is very important... without accommodation you virtually cannot do anything... I MEAN NOTHING.. to get your resident permit... bank....insurance.. YOU NEED ACCOMMODATION.. n no be beans... don’t bother contacting the school for that(NOT IN ALL CASES THOUGH, YOU CAN TRY) but priority is given to scholarship students and Erasmus students first... before consideration to others and it is rare. Kind regards, |

konja44:If you are applying to Gent University.. have in mind that you will legalise your document twice... You legalise your original for Visa application and You legalise the photocopy of your original certificates, these photocopies are the one you will send to the school. N:B you wil be requested to send hard copies of your credentials... that’s when they need your legalised document.. more so, legalise only official document and the document you intend they( UGENT) use to judge your admission application.. |
